  • Bend offers plenty of possibilities for anyone looking for a short ride through the area. Let your guide plan out the day and visit some of the exhilarating trails such as Whoops Loop famous for its downhill ride. If you are a beginner and want to hone your skills, Phil’s Trail is one of the best trails in the area for you. Work on your technical knowledge, enjoy your day, and reward yourself with scenic panoramas and a glass of beer or kombucha with your guide!

    • You will need to be able to bike between two and six hours, depending on the itinerary you choose. After booking, your guide will determine the group’s skill level and capabilities and cater the day to your specific abilities. Keep in mind, opting for the full day option means more biking, which is strenuous even if you stay on beginner level trails.

    • As long as you pedal on two wheels, you can book this adventure. A guide will explain the different mountain bike techniques and body positions to get you feeling comfortable on the trial. You will progress at a level that is consistent with your comfort. Once you finally get the hang of trail riding, you will only want more!

    • To get to Bend, most people fly into Portland International Airport (PDX). From there, you can rent a car or take a shuttle service the 3.5 hours southeast to Bend.

      Once you and your guide agree on the details of your itinerary, your guide will suggest the best place to meet. Most of the tours and lessons start from the Cog Wild headquarters location. The guide will choose the appropriate terrain dependent on conditions and ability of the group.
